> I am developing a Performer 2.0 (OpenGL) based application and I am using
> one local lightsource. It works fine on Impacts and IRs, but on an Onyx the
> colors of the geometry totally flips.
> Can anyone help? Is there a patch for this?

Tomas

There was bug on 5.3/6.3 RE2 with local lights and GL_AMBIENT_AND_DIFFUSE
lighting. It's fixed in the Irix 6.2 patch 1442 ( RE rollup patch ). Try
installing that. I think that'll do it but you ought to have it on RE2 running
6.2 anyway.
